colleges26universities in St Louis, MO

  1. Water Tower Inn
    3545 Lafayette Ave Saint LouisMO63104 (314) 977-7500 2.3 mi
  2. St Louis County Communicable 111 S Meramec Ave Saint LouisMO63105 (314) 615-1630 7.8 mi
  3. St. Charles Community College
    4601 Mid Rivers Mall Dr Saint PetersMO63376 (636) 922-8000 25.6 mi